Step-by-Step Solution for the Director

Step 1: Establish Workspaces for Departments

- Action: Create distinct Workspaces for each department (e.g., Research, Marketing, Compliance) to centralize and organize functions.

- Procedure: Navigate to the main dashboard, select 'Create New Workspace,' provide a name, and set permissions.

Step 2: Develop Spaces for Projects

- Action: Within each Workspace, create Spaces for specific projects or focus areas to promote inter-departmental collaboration.

- Procedure: Click 'Add Space,' choose types like Workflow or Informational Space, and assign roles.

Step 3: Implement Cards for Task Management

- Action: Use Cards to represent tasks within Spaces, capturing essential project information and enabling agile task management.

- Procedure: Add Cards, customize details, manage statuses like 'To Do,' 'In-Process,' and 'Completed.'

Step 4: Enhance Team Communication and Collaboration

- Action: Use KanBo to break down communication silos and foster cross-functional collaboration.

- Procedure: Utilize comments on Cards for discussions, mention colleagues in updates, and utilize the Activity Stream for real-time logging.

Step 5: Optimize Resource Management

- Action: Leverage the Resource Management module to allocate and monitor resource utilization effectively, reducing waste and improving efficiency.

- Procedure: Set up allocations within Spaces, view Resources and Utilization, and manage requests via the My Resources section.

Step 6: Facilitate Transparent Decision-Making

- Action: Empower team leaders by decentralizing decision-making processes within Workspaces and Spaces.

- Procedure: Assign leadership roles, minimize approval chains, and utilize real-time progress tracking for decision support.

Step 7: Conduct a Kickoff Meeting and Training

- Action: Host an introductory meeting to familiarize the team with KanBo’s features and encourage adoption.

- Procedure: Schedule a session within Spaces, invite members, and conduct hands-on demonstrations.

Glossary of Key KanBo Terms

Introduction

KanBo is a comprehensive platform designed to streamline work coordination by connecting daily operations with broader company strategies. By offering features such as workflow management, task visualization, and integration with Microsoft products, KanBo provides an efficient solution for project management and communication. Understanding the terms associated with KanBo is essential for effectively leveraging its capabilities. Below is a glossary to help navigate and utilize KanBo's features effectively.

Glossary of Terms

- Hybrid Environment:

- A flexible setup allowing KanBo to operate both on-premises and in the cloud, addressing different data governance and compliance needs.

- Customization:

- The ability to personalize on-premises KanBo systems, offering more flexibility than traditional SaaS solutions.

- Integration:

- KanBo's compatibility with Microsoft products like SharePoint, Teams, and Office 365, enabling a seamless user experience.

- Data Management:

- The practice of reserving sensitive data on-premises while managing other data in the cloud for balanced security and accessibility.

- Workspaces:

- Highest level in KanBo's hierarchy serving as containers for teams or projects. They organize Spaces and Folders.

- Spaces:

- Subsections within Workspaces or Folders that represent projects or specific focus areas, hosting Cards for collaboration.

- Cards:

- Basic task units within Spaces containing actionable items, notes, files, and comments.

- Resource Allocation:

- The practice of reserving and managing resources (time-based or unit-based) for tasks within KanBo.

- Resource Management Module:

- A KanBo tool for handling resources through allocations, facilitating high-level and detailed project planning.

- Allocations:

- Reservations for resource sharing, which can be basic or duration-based, requiring approval from resource managers.

- Roles and Permissions:

- Defined access levels in KanBo, ensuring structured management of resources and user responsibilities.

- Resource Views (Resources and Utilization):

- Insights into resource allocation, showing time dedicated to each task or the overall resource use in a Space.

- KanBo Licenses:

- Tiered licenses (Business, Enterprise, Strategic) determining the extent of accessible features, particularly affecting resource management capabilities.

- Space Templates:

- Pre-defined setups for standardizing workflows within KanBo to maintain consistency across projects.

- Card and Document Templates:

- Saved structures for efficiently creating tasks and documents, ensuring consistency and streamlined operations.

- Forecast and Time Charts:

- Visual tools for tracking project progress and analyzing workflow efficiency through various metrics.
